Type
ORACLE
Validation date
2024-07-10 23:34: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01352,
    "usd": 0.01465
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001681377E3B0400357A08C68FE6D21E3BDACA594DFDD357C8B8D1D68D96EB0E434

Previous signature

C98056558D0256E6592DB3B2E1CE6E7A6DDC5D07568B391BD022186092021605CA16B988D5FDDB03C7262ECCDF246681F9ECFBAAC12D6E2F9B825BC05682B800

Origin signature

3045022100844899E48326F716F9C4E406A8BDF165E3FEA90FC1D4E04A384D3B14C9AD909C02200FF79D598762066BAE0C63DEEF8A898BBBFCF9AC4D01AF888EE72FB1DA99F2FB

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00DF08097252221A4340394F96EDFA61D0ADEE10588244C400B10A93ACD3392EC4

Coordinator signature

1098CE7A3C65B52CD4A0716A1F303F35E807ED018E4EA722381D05D2928F15F14A24381BA833F7D411F3C079448B2DA09CE7C803F6E8C272A485D625D96CEB08

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

536FD5FCFF22A46D5835C029682AE5808FDA90A1AF66A7DC9183A0B2E098D817717C50B7ECE3AE57F34C1A64525F92ACA8B1D25CB15F978220229FFA2806F803

Validator #2 public key

000198C9CA234A4CA85D4A7B9C05C10B9434D24B7FF495E397043C27DC456B39739D

Validator #2 signature

AC30C90F6C8F7B8F46D4EB229FE2A1C21C64B7349EEA79F6F2015D231ED6928DA0F464224B03D0D1F174B1FD4A56BBE94D3DB8E51ECCF87B427ECC9C5273650E